Pros & cons

Hoover WindTunnel All-Terrain

  • Dual brushroll system finally makes a WindTunnel good on hard floors
  • Costs $100-150 less than comparable Shark and Dyson uprights
  • Two-speed brushroll and strong direct suction on carpet
  • 30 ft cord and 7 ft hose give big cleaning reach
  • LED headlights and 1.5 L easy-empty dirt cup
  • 5-year limited warranty
  • No lift-away pod — stairs mean carrying the whole 16 lb machine
  • Not a fully sealed HEPA system like Shark's Anti-Allergen uprights
  • Filter is a 12-month replaceable, not lifetime washable
  • No automatic floor-type sensing
  • Bulky to store

Bissell Pet Hair Eraser Turbo Lift-Off

  • Sealed HEPA system at a price where most rivals leak fine dust
  • Self-cleaning FurGuard brushroll strips wrapped hair on command
  • Lift-Off pod detaches for stairs and car cleaning
  • TurboBrush pivot tool is excellent on upholstery and cat trees
  • LED-lit dustbin shows when fur is packing the cyclone
  • 5-year limited warranty
  • Small 0.75 L dustbin fills fast in a shedding household
  • Lift-Off mode pulls suction through the hose only — weaker than upright mode
  • Long human hair still needs occasional manual removal
  • 15.5 lbs is mid-pack, not light
  • Street price swings widely — wait for the frequent sub-$250 sales
